An Executive Certificate in Smart Grids Security provides professionals with in-depth knowledge of cybersecurity threats and mitigation strategies within the power grid infrastructure. This specialized program equips participants with practical skills to address evolving challenges in a rapidly changing energy landscape.
Learning outcomes typically include mastering risk assessment methodologies, understanding advanced persistent threats (APTs) targeting smart grid components, and implementing robust security protocols such as intrusion detection and prevention systems. Participants gain expertise in vulnerability analysis and penetration testing, crucial for effective Smart Grids Security.
